Нейросеть

Технологии Разработки Социальных Программ: Анализ и Практическое Применение (Реферат)

Нейросеть для реферата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ный реферат посвящен всестороннему исследованию технологий разработки социальных программ. Он начинается с обзора фундаментальных принципов и подходов к проектированию социальных приложений, включая анализ пользовательского опыта и платформенные аспекты. Далее следует углубленный анализ архитектуры современных социальных платформ, методов обеспечения безопасности и масштабируемости. Особое внимание уделяется практическим примерам и конкретным кейсам, иллюстрирующим успешные стратегии разработки и внедрения.

Результаты:

Ожидается, что работа предоставит глубокое понимание современных технологий разработки социальных программ и их практического применения.

Актуальность:

Актуальность исследования обусловлена растущей ролью социальных программ в современной коммуникации и необходимости эффективных методик их разработки.

Цель:

Целью исследования является анализ ключевых технологий разработки социальных программ и выявление перспективных направлений их развития.

Наименование образовательного учреждения

Реферат

на тему

Технологии Разработки Социальных Программ: Анализ и Практическое Применение

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ы разработки социальных программ 2
    • - Архитектура социальных платформ 2.1
    • - Методы обеспечения безопасности социальных программ 2.2
    • - Принципы UX/UI дизайна для социальных программ 2.3
  • Инструменты и технологии разработки социальных программ 3
    • - Языки программирования и фреймворки 3.1
    • - Базы данных и хранение данных 3.2
    • - API и интеграция с внешними сервисами 3.3
  • Машинное обучение и искусственный интеллект в социальных программах 4
    • - Анализ текстовых данных и обработка естественного языка (NLP) 4.1
    • - Рекомендательные системы 4.2
    • - Распознавание изображений и видео 4.3
  • Практическое применение: Кейс-стадии социальных программ 5
    • - Анализ успешных социальных сетей 5.1
    • - Разработка и продвижение мессенджеров 5.2
    • - Разработка онлайн-сообществ и форумов 5.3
  • Заключение 6
  • Список литературы 7

Введение

Содержимое раздела

Введение определяет область исследования, обосновывает актуальность темы и формулирует основные цели и задачи работы. Рассматриваются ключевые понятия, такие как социальные программы, их классификация и роль в современном обществе. Описывается структура реферата и его методологическая основа. Представляется обзор существующих исследований в данной области с указанием их основных достижений и недостатков.

Теоретические основы разработки социальных программ

Содержимое раздела

Этот раздел закладывает теоретическую основу для дальнейшего анализа, рассматривая архитектурные принципы социальных программ. Обсуждаются современные парадигмы программирования и подходы к разработке, адаптированные для социальных приложений. Особое внимание уделяется вопросам управления данными, безопасности и конфиденциальности пользователей, а также методам обеспечения масштабируемости и производительности платформ. Кроме того, анализируются принципы взаимодействия "человек-компьютер" в контексте социальных приложений.

    Архитектура социальных платформ

    Содержимое раздела

    Описываются основные архитектурные компоненты социальных платформ, включая клиентскую часть, серверную часть и базы данных. Анализируются различные типы архитектур, применяемые в социальных сетях и мессенджерах. Обсуждаются вопросы масштабируемости, отказоустойчивости и оптимизации производительности архитектурных решений. Рассматриваются современные подходы к разработке микросервисных архитектур для социальных программ.

    Методы обеспечения безопасности социальных программ

    Содержимое раздела

    Рассматриваются современные методы обеспечения безопасности социальных программ, включая защиту от взломов, утечек данных и фишинговых атак. Обсуждаются принципы аутентификации и авторизации пользователей, а также методы шифрования данных. Анализируются современные стандарты безопасности и лучшие практики разработки безопасных социальных приложений. Подробно изучаются инструменты для выявления и предотвращения угроз безопасности.

    Принципы UX/UI дизайна для социальных программ

    Содержимое раздела

    Этот подраздел посвящен принципам проектирования пользовательского опыта (UX) и пользовательского интерфейса (UI) социальных программ. Обсуждаются методы анализа пользовательских потребностей и разработки удобных интерфейсов. Рассматриваются принципы визуального дизайна, адаптивного дизайна и других аспектов UI/UX, влияющих на пользовательское взаимодействие и вовлеченность. Анализируются лучшие практики дизайна интерфейсов социальных программ.

Инструменты и технологии разработки социальных программ

Содержимое раздела

Раздел освещает используемые инструменты и технологии для разработки социальных программ, от языков программирования до фреймворков и библиотек. Обсуждаются ключевые технологии бэкенда, такие как Node.js, Python/Django, Ruby on Rails, Java/Spring, и их применение в социальных приложениях. Рассматриваются инструменты фронтенда, включая React, Angular, Vue.js. Анализируются базы данных, а также технологии облачных вычислений для развертывания.

    Языки программирования и фреймворки

    Содержимое раздела

    Рассматриваются наиболее популярные языки программирования. Особое внимание уделяется языкам, наиболее часто используемым при создании социальных платформ. Анализируются преимущества и недостатки различных фреймворков. Обсуждаются инструменты для управления зависимостями и сборки проектов. Рассматривается роль языков программирования в обеспечении безопасности и масштабируемости социальных проектов.

    Базы данных и хранение данных

    Содержимое раздела

    Обсуждаются различные типы баз данных (SQL, NoSQL). Рассматриваются преимущества и недостатки каждого типа в контексте социальных программ. Анализируются методы проектирования баз данных для хранения данных пользователей, сообщений и других данных социальных сетей. Обсуждаются вопросы оптимизации производительности запросов и масштабируемости хранения данных.

    API и интеграция с внешними сервисами

    Содержимое раздела

    Рассматриваются принципы разработки и использования API для интеграции социальных программ с другими сервисами. Обсуждаются популярные протоколы и стандарты API. Анализируются примеры интеграции с API социальных платформ, платежных систем и других сервисов. Рассматриваются вопросы безопасности и управления доступом к API.

Машинное обучение и искусственный интеллект в социальных программах

Содержимое раздела

Этот раздел посвящен применению машинного обучения и искусственного интеллекта (ИИ) в социальных программах. Рассматриваются алгоритмы, такие как распознавание изображений, обработка естественного языка и рекомендательные системы. Обсуждаются способы использования ИИ для улучшения пользовательского опыта, персонализации контента и автоматизации задач. Анализируются этические аспекты применения ИИ в социальных сетях.

    Анализ текстовых данных и обработка естественного языка (NLP)

    Содержимое раздела

    Описываются методы анализа текстовых данных, применяемые в социальных программах, такие как анализ настроений, распознавание сущностей и классификация текстов. Обсуждаются инструменты и библиотеки для обработки естественного языка (NLP). Рассматриваются примеры использования NLP для модерации контента, анализа общественного мнения и улучшения взаимодействия с пользователями.

    Рекомендательные системы

    Содержимое раздела

    Рассматриваются принципы работы рекомендательных систем, применяемых в социальных программах для предоставления пользователям персонализированного контента. Обсуждаются различные типы рекомендательных систем (коллективная фильтрация, контентная фильтрация) и алгоритмы, используемые в них. Анализируются примеры реализации рекомендательных систем в социальных сетях и мессенджерах.

    Распознавание изображений и видео

    Содержимое раздела

    Описываются методы распознавания изображений и видео, применяемые в социальных программах для анализа контента. Обсуждаются алгоритмы и нейронные сети для распознавания объектов, лиц и действий на изображениях и видео. Рассматриваются примеры использования технологий распознавания изображений и видео в социальных сетях для автоматической модерации контента, поиска и классификации.

Практическое применение: Кейс-стадии социальных программ

Содержимое раздела

Раздел содержит практические примеры и анализ конкретных кейсов успешных социальных программ. Рассматриваются особенности разработки, внедрения и продвижения различных типов социальных платформ, включая социальные сети, мессенджеры, форумы и онлайн-сообщества. Анализируются стратегии монетизации, привлечения пользователей, а также решения проблем масштабирования и обеспечения безопасности.

    Анализ успешных социальных сетей

    Содержимое раздела

    Проводится детальный анализ успешных социальных сетей. Обсуждаются их архитектура, технологии и стратегии развития. Анализируются факторы, которые способствовали их успеху, такие как пользовательский опыт, функциональность и маркетинговые стратегии. Рассматриваются примеры инновационных решений и подходов.

    Разработка и продвижение мессенджеров

    Содержимое раздела

    Обсуждаются особенности разработки и продвижения мессенджеров, основные технологические решения, а также методы привлечения и удержания пользователей. Рассматриваются способы обеспечения приватности и безопасности коммуникаций. Анализируются примеры успешных мессенджеров и их стратегии развития.

    Разработка онлайн-сообществ и форумов

    Содержимое раздела

    Рассматриваются особенности разработки и управления онлайн-сообществами и форумами. Обсуждаются инструменты и технологии для создания и модерации контента, а также методы вовлечения пользователей. Анализируются примеры успешных онлайн-сообществ и форумов.

Заключение

Содержимое раздела

В заключении обобщаются основные результаты исследования, делаются выводы о ключевых трендах и перспективах развития технологий разработки социальных программ. Оценивается вклад работы в научную область и формулируются рекомендации для дальнейших исследований. Подчеркивается важность учета этических аспектов и вопросов безопасности при разработке социальных приложений.

Список литературы

Содержимое раздела

В разделе представлен список использованных источников, включая научные статьи, книги, интернет-ресурсы и другие материалы, цитированные в реферате. Он оформляется в соответствии с принятыми стандартами цитирования (ГОСТ или другие). Приводится полный перечень всех ссылок, чтобы обеспечить возможность проверки и подтверждения информации, использованной в работе.

Получи Такой Реферат

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Реферат на любую тему за 5 минут

Создать

#5614846